[0105] This embodiment provides an analog measuring point associating device, which is used for associating the vibration sensor on the display interface with the vibration sensor installed on the vibration device, so as to ensure that the state of the monitoring part displayed by the analog measuring point is not confused. like Figure 5 shown, including:

[0106] The acquiring module 501 is configured to acquire vibration sensor information and equipment images; wherein, each vibration sensor information includes a unique identification information. For details, please refer to the relevant description of step S101 in Embodiment 1, which will not be repeated here.

[0107] The generating module 502 is configured to generate analog measuring points corresponding to the vibration sensor based on the unique identification information, so that the analog measuring points have different identification marks. Abstract

The invention relates to the field of data processing, in particular to a simulation measuring point association method and device, equipment and a storage medium, and the method comprises the following steps: obtaining vibration sensor information and an equipment image; wherein each piece of vibration sensor information comprises unique identification information; based on the unique identification information, generating simulation measuring points corresponding to the vibration sensor, so that the simulation measuring points have different identification marks; moving the simulation measuring points to corresponding positions of the equipment image, and associating the vibration sensor with the simulation measuring point based on the identification mark and the unique identification information. It is guaranteed that no error occurs in association between the vibration sensor and the simulation measuring point, and then it is guaranteed that display of the simulation measuring point on the display interface is not disordered.

technical field [0001] The invention relates to the field of data processing, in particular to a method, device, equipment and storage medium for associating analog measuring points. Background technique [0002] The working process of the equipment is often accompanied by vibration, but when there is abnormal vibration in a certain part of the equipment, it may affect the working status of the equipment, and may even cause production accidents. In order to find out whether there is abnormal vibration in the working process of the equipment in time, it is necessary to install a vibration sensor on the equipment under test to monitor the vibration status of each part of the equipment in real time, and display the vibration status of each part on the equipment image.
